It surely seems only a matter of time before Joshua Zirkzee is signed by Manchester United Football Club.

The 23-year-old Dutch international is being heavily linked with United amid reports that the Red Devils are now frontrunners for his signature.

That means many United fans with a simple question – how much will he cost?

United have had a history of paying over the odds for players. The likes of Antony, Jadon Sancho, Romelu Lukaku, Angel Di Maria and Harry Maguire are all players that fans can agree cost too much as the club overspent based on the players’ subsequent performances.

While the days of Sir Alex Ferguson and David Gill long gone, there is optimism that INEOS are going to run a much tighter ship. And Zirkzee’s transfer could be the start of a new approach to the transfer market.

Thanks to a report from the Manchester Evening News, we now know what the potential costs will be.

The paper reports that the total figure required to acquire the player will be around £46m.

£46m is made up of a £33m (€40m) release clause as well as agent commission of around £13m.

According to previous reports, the agent fees were one of the main reasons that the likes of AC Milan pulled out of the deal.

It seems that the figure is a lot more palatable to the United hierarchy – who spent around £72m last summer on the signing of striker Rasmus Hojlund.

If Zirkzee’s transfer does come off, he’ll be the second striker brought into the club over successive seasons from Serie A.

Zirkzee has scored 14 goals across 58 appearances for Bologna in Italy. The attacker is currently on international duty at UEFA Euros 2024, where he has been on the bench for all four games that his country has played.
